IL23 is an alias of the human IL23A gene, which encodes the protein, interleukin 23 subunit alpha. Notably, IL23 is known to play a role in immune response pathways, among other functions. The IL23A protein is described to be 189 amino acid residues in length and 20.7 kilodaltons in mass. It is known to be a secreted protein. Other names for this target antigen include IL23P19.
